The Broadcasting Board of Governors (BBG) is conducting a second Request for Information (RFI) to ascertain Industry's capability to provide surveys, installation, hosting, operation, maintenance, and technical support of the Broadcasting Board of Governors’ (BBG) Frequency Modulation (FM), Television (TV) and satellite uplink/downlink stations in the Middle East, Africa and South Asia. The BBG anticipates a future need for a Contractor (or Contractors) to survey, install, provide hosting services, operational and maintenance (O&M) services and technical oversight for approximately seventy (70) FM transmitter systems and approximately five (5) television transmitter systems located throughout the Middle East, Africa and South Asia; Provide site survey, installation, O&M and other technical services throughout the Middle East, Arabic speaking North Africa, Sub-Saharan Africa and South Asia as needed by the BBG; Provide timely technical support directly or on-contract to maintain high transmission availability at all responsible transmission locations; and Shall have the ability to communicate in Arabic and other local languages by telephone, Short Message Services (SMS) and/or email with all transmission locations, and travel freely throughout the Middle East, North Africa, Sub-Saharan Africa and South Asia. BACKGROUND :. BBG anticipates a future procurement with the award of a firm fixed-price (FFP) indefinite delivery indefinite quantity (IDIQ) contract with a Base Year and four (4) yearly options, subject to the availability of funding. In addition, BBG may make multiple contract awards if, after review of submissions, it is determined that no single firm can accomplish all the BBG requirements at every location. BBG currently has anticipated operational requirements as follows: A. Provide hosting services, operational and maintenance (O&M) services and technical oversight for approximately twenty-six (26) FM transmitter systems and approximately five (5) television transmitter systems located at approximately fifteen (15) widely separated sites in Iraq; B. Provide technical oversight for approximately two (2) FM transmitter systems in Jordan; C. Provide technical oversight for approximately six (6) FM transmitter systems in Lebanon; D. Provide hosting services, O&M services and technical oversight for approximately three (3) FM transmitter systems in Libya; E. Provide hosting services, O&M services and technical oversight for approximately six (6) FM transmitter systems in Morocco; F. Provide hosting services, O&M services and technical oversight for approximately four (4) FM transmitter systems in Palestine; G. Provide hosting services, O&M services and technical oversight for one (1) possible FM transmitter system in Chad; and H. Provide technical oversight for approximately fifteen (15) FM transmitter systems in Afghanistan. I. BBG also anticipates having site surveys, system installation and emergency maintenance requirements on an as-needed basis throughout the target areas. Please be advised that BBG and the U.S. Government will NOT provide personnel or facility security in any of the locations. There presently is an incumbent Contractor(s) with broadcast equipment in place at most of the named locations and operating at the incumbent's owned/leased facilities. The incumbent's facilities may NOT be transferable to another Contractor for a future procurement. Also, in some locations, BBG has separate O&M contracts in place whereby the incumbent Contractor provides technical support to BBG. Interested Parties are cautioned that it is mandatory that BBG broadcasts NOT be interrupted during any future procurement or transition process which MAY mean the future contractor provides and installs its own equipment/facilities during the transition period.
